Total Solar Eclipse 2017
Update: Did you get glasses to watch the eclipse? You don't have to just throw them out. You can donate your eclipse glasses to schools outside the U.S. Astronomers Without Borders is offering to collect them ahead of eclipses in South America and Asia.
On August 21, 2017, there will be a coast-to-coast total solar eclipse that has not been seen in nearly 100 years. The next total solar eclipse over North America will be on April 8, 2024. An eclipse with a similar path across U.S. will not be back until August of 2045.
It is estimated that between 1.5 million and 5 million people may travel into the path of the eclipse.

Secret Tool For Sneaky Vacation Planning On The Low At Work
mashable.com/2017/04/07/kayak-sfw-vacation-planning
The site just launched a brand new under-the-radar page design to help wanderlusting office drones plan out their trips at work without risking the wrath of busybody bosses. KAYAK At Work looks just like an Excel doc—but it's actually a fully-functional trip planning page.
